What? Your main hand determines the bonus, not the effect on just 1 hand. You misunderstand the passive. 15% more attack speed = more fury. Each hit; regardless of whether or not you have 2 Mighty weapons, will generate 3 additional fury as long as your main hand weapon is Mighty.
Frenzy + Maniac - Default Generator modified for some added damage buffing.
Whirlwind + Wind Shear - Main spender with added Fury Generation per hit.
Rend + Bloodbath - Main AoE fury spender, not sure if Bloodbath or Ravage would be more effective from reading the tooltips.
Ignore Pain + Ignorrance is Bliss - "OH SHIT!!" button. If life goes down to much just tapping Ignore Pain and WW'ing should help protect yourself from incoming hits and leach back your life quickly.
Battle Rage + Into the Fray - Damage Buff and added 15 Fury per Crit Strike. With high speed Frenzy attacks and WW'ing I count on the Barb doing crits often enough.
WotB + Thrive on Chaos - Main buff with Thrive on Chaos to keep it alive as much as possible with all the Fury Generation
Nerves of Steel - Big Armor Bonus
Weapons Master - Added Fury generation from either Criting more with Maces/Axes (maybe faster attack speed than Mighty Weapons I suppose) or just straight up using Mighty Weapons for the 3 Fury per Hit.
Animosity - Furty Generation Buff
I think this build should survive anything that comes at it and still be able to deal with single targets and large mobs effectively. One thing the OP did bring up that interests me would be switching Rend for Sprint + Marathon to help it get from mob to mob even faster but I don't think that it would be worth it to add even faster mobility and sacrifice my big AoE skill, unless WW on its own proves to be powerful enough at inflicting widespread damage on its own. In that case I would switch to Sprint + Marathon in a heartbeat. I would love to emulate my D2 barbarian build that used Frenzy and WW while running all over the place like a mad man.

Regardless I don't see Frenzy as a main skill to kill mobs, you'll still need a bigger attack that spends fury to mix in there.
It's a fury generator. Only when you add in Sidearm does it become viable on anything OTHER than bosses.
